Summary Do you have a passion for food The National Trust is renowned for its food and hospitality. We run 185 cafes all over England, Wales and Northern Ireland, and wed love you to be a part of it.We’re looking for a Cook to join us. Because we are in a rural area, please think about how you’d be able to get here for work, before applying for the job.Benefits: We want to help you look after the things that matter to you, such as saving for your future, getting a discount on your weekly shop, or encouraging you to find a work-life balance. Please read our package, below, to see what benefitswe offer you.Hours: 1950 hours per year. Will require weekend working, no evenings & no split shifts.This role is based on annualised hours, where the amount of hours you work each month may vary, however your salary will be paid in 12 equal instalments over the year.Salary: £23,166 paDuration: PermanentInterview date:Potential start date: ASAP What its like to work here To find out more about what it’s like to work in a food and beverage team for the National Trust,clickhere towatch our video. What youll be doing As a Cook, your focus will be in the kitchen, helping to prepare and present deliciousfood from scratch using fresh, seasonal ingredients. Your food will be served directly to visitors.Using the framework of our ‘National Trust Cookbook’, you’ll prepare, measure and mix ingredients. You’ll help with deliveries and with keeping the kitchenclean, to be compliant with health and safety legislation and to make sure that service runs smoothly.We’ll give you an induction that fits the job, and training in allergens and food safety, plus any mentoring needed to help you in your role. You can signup for further professional training and development if you wish.Please also read the full role profile, attached to this advert. Who were looking for We’d love to hear from you if you’re: •Someone who loves good food and has a friendly and positive attitude. •Confident about following recipes and batch-cooking, and willing to learn. •Aware of health and safety compliance.
